Topic: Indigenous Status CodeSystem url
Brett Esler (Apr 04 2017 at 04:03):
Currently in draft AU-base IG indigenous status codesystem url has been defined as http://meteor.aihw.gov.au/content/index.phtml/itemId/602543#Codes - propose we drop the '#Codes' reference as this seems to be a non-existent anchor
David McKillop (Apr 04 2017 at 04:41):
+1 drop the non-existent anchor "#Codes".
Richard Townley-O'Neill (Apr 04 2017 at 05:35):
Maybe the #Codes is meant to guide you to the _Value domain attributes_ section.
_Person—Indigenous status, code N_ is a Data Element, a combination of a Data Element Concept (Person—Indigenous status) and a value domain (code N)
So http://meteor.aihw.gov.au/content/index.phtml/itemId/602543 is for the data element and http://meteor.aihw.gov.au/content/index.phtml/itemId/602543#Codes is for the description of the codes used in that data element.
So the semantics can be different, even if the anchor has been missed.
Richard Townley-O'Neill (Apr 04 2017 at 05:36):
That would suggest checking with METeOR whether my analysis is correct, and if it is, asking them to put in the missing anchor.
